ROLES AND RESPONSIBILITIES:
Program Coordination Travel Logistics
- Coordinate travel, itineraries, and logistics for conferences, trainings, experiential learning, and college visits
- Organize field trip permissions, initial enrollment records, and other required documentation as needed across various YYP programs
- Provide support for parent communications
- Foster positive relationships between families, students, teachers, staff and clients Data & Grant Administration
- Monitor data entry from multiple departments to ensure integrity and timely reporting
- Track key grant outcomes and prepare data for reporting
- Support managers in monitoring the Youth Prosperity budget to ensure appropriate spending
- Collaborate with Mission Advancement to ensure matching funds and compliance requirements are met
- Grant management- monitor and compile data for grant reporting Outreach & Marketing
- Lead outreach and marketing for Youth Prosperity programming
- Maintain updated promotional and informational materials for distribution
- Schedule meetings, trainings, and special events
- Maintain organized filing systems (digital and physical) for program documentation
- Track program supplies and assist with general office logistics
- Provide administrative support to the Division Director and program managers as needed
- Perform standard clerical work including correspondence, copying, and filing
- Complete other duties as assigned and determined by the Division Director of Community
